Little Monster

So some of you have wanted to know why I call my daughter Little Monster. 

Is it because she is, in fact, an actual little monster that clawed her way out of my womb much like the demon baby in Breaking Dawn?  No, of course not (sometimes).



photo courtesy of princessbella at fanpop
 
She is known as Little Monster because she is Lady Gaga's biggest fan (okay, let's be honest here...I'm a huge fan, and it might have kinda sorta rubbed off on Little Monster).  And we all know Gaga calls her fans Little Monsters.

photo courtesy of ME (and my bestie Jennie)

And I'm proud of that.  It's fun to talk to Little Monster about Gaga, and how she likes to pretend but it's always to make a statement, and make people think about issues and feel good about themselves.  Little Monster loves looking at Gaga's costumes and performances and thinks she is just beautiful.  And she is, inside and out.

Her new song Born This Way is so emotional because it inspires me to talk to my daughter about loving herself and respecting everyone, no matter who they are.  And I think Gaga is a perfect example of that.
